Can A Police Officer Afford Rent in North Canton, OH?

Comfortably affordable — rent takes 22.7% of gross income.

North Canton rent: June 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Ohio state estimate).

North Canton median rent
$1,373/mo
Police Officer salary (Ohio)
$72,634/yr
Rent as % of income
22.7%
Gross monthly income works out to about $6,053,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,816/mo in rent. North Canton's median rent of $1,373 leaves roughly $443/mo of headroom under that threshold. A police officer works roughly 39.3 hours a month to cover that r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Ohio state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for North Canton, OH.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
